怎么在服务器上安装php环境
-
在服务器上安装PHP环境需要按照以下步骤进行操作:
1. 确认服务器系统:首先检查服务器的操作系统,常见的服务器操作系统包括Windows Server、Linux(如Ubuntu、CentOS等)和Mac OS X Server。根据不同操作系统选择相应的方法进行安装。
2. 选择合适的Web服务器软件:在安装PHP环境之前,需要先选择并安装一个Web服务器软件,比较常见的有Apache、Nginx、IIS等。选择一个适合自己需求的Web服务器软件,根据对应的安装方法进行安装。
3. 下载PHP安装包:访问PHP官方网站(https://www.php.net/),下载与服务器操作系统相对应的PHP安装包。选择稳定版本,并根据服务器的硬件架构选择对应的下载包(例如Windows x86或x64版、Linux 32位或64位)。
4. 安装PHP:将下载好的PHP安装包解压至合适的目录,根据操作系统的不同,执行对应安装脚本。在Windows系统中,可以使用参考安装包中的指南进行安装。在Linux系统中,可以通过命令行运行./configure命令进行配置,然后运行make和make install完成安装。
5. 配置Web服务器:根据所安装的Web服务器软件的不同,需要进行相应的配置才能与PHP环境关联起来。比如,Apache服务器的配置文件是httpd.conf,可以通过添加LoadModule和AddHandler等指令来启用PHP解析器。
6. 测试安装是否成功:在Web服务器的根目录下(如Apache的htdocs目录),创建一个test.php文件,文件中内容为“`php phpinfo(); “` 保存文件后,打开浏览器并输入服务器IP地址或域名,加上/test.php进行访问。如果出现PHP配置信息页面,说明PHP安装成功。
7. 配置PHP:根据项目需求,进行PHP的相关配置,如修改php.ini配置文件,开启或关闭某些扩展模块,设置时区、上传文件大小限制等。
8. 安装扩展模块:根据具体需求,可以选择安装一些常用的扩展模块,如MySQL数据库扩展、GD图像处理扩展等。安装方法一般是下载对应的扩展模块源码包,然后编译安装。
通过以上步骤,就可以在服务器上成功安装PHP环境,并进行相应的配置和调整,以适应项目的需求。整个过程需要根据实际情况进行操作,并确保服务器网络连接正常和具备管理员权限。
2年前 -
在服务器上安装PHP环境可以按照以下步骤进行:
1. 选择合适的操作系统:首先确定服务器使用的操作系统,常见的服务器操作系统包括Linux、Windows和Mac OS。具体的安装方式会因操作系统而异。
2. 安装必要的软件:在服务器上安装PHP环境前,需要安装一些必要的软件,包括Web服务器(如Apache、Nginx)、PHP解释器和数据库服务器(如MySQL)。这些软件可以通过包管理工具(如apt、yum、brew)进行安装。
3. 配置Web服务器:安装完Web服务器后,需要对其进行基本配置。这包括设置网站根目录、启用PHP解释器模块以及配置虚拟主机等。具体的配置方法可以参考对应Web服务器的文档。
4. 安装和配置PHP解释器:将PHP解释器安装到服务器中,可以通过源码编译安装或者使用包管理工具安装。安装完毕后,需要进行一些基本的配置,例如设置PHP.ini文件中的参数、启用需要的扩展等。
5. 测试PHP环境:在安装完PHP环境后,可以通过创建一个简单的PHP文件来测试环境是否正常工作。在Web服务器的网站根目录中创建一个index.php文件,其中包含测试代码,然后通过浏览器访问该文件,如果能够看到预期的输出,说明PHP环境安装成功。
此外,为了确保服务器的安全性和性能,还应该采取一些安全措施,例如限制PHP的执行权限、设置合适的文件和目录权限、安装防火墙等。
需要注意的是,服务器环境的安装和配置可能有一定的复杂性,如果没有相关经验或技术知识,建议寻求专业人员或者使用托管服务进行安装和配置。
2年前 -
在服务器上安装PHP环境有多种方法,下面将介绍最常见的几种方法。
方法一:使用软件包管理工具
1. 更新软件包列表:使用以下命令更新软件包列表,确保系统为最新状态。
“`
sudo apt update
“`2. 安装PHP和相关插件:使用以下命令安装PHP和常用的扩展插件。
“`
sudo apt install php libapache2-mod-php php-mysql
“`3. 验证安装结果:安装完成后,可以使用以下命令来验证PHP是否安装成功。
“`
php -v
“`方法二:通过编译源代码安装
1. 下载PHP源代码:首先,需要从PHP官方网站(https://www.php.net/downloads.php)下载PHP源代码的压缩包,并解压到指定的目录。
2. 安装编译依赖:使用以下命令安装编译PHP所需的依赖项。
“`
sudo apt install build-essential libxml2-dev libssl-dev libcurl4-openssl-dev libpng-dev libjpeg-dev
“`3. 配置和编译:进入解压后的PHP源代码目录,运行以下命令进行配置。
“`
./configure –with-apxs2=/usr/bin/apxs –with-mysql –with-curl –with-openssl –with-gd
“`然后,运行以下命令进行编译和安装。
“`
make
sudo make install
“`4. 验证安装结果:安装完成后,可以使用以下命令来验证PHP是否安装成功。
“`
php -v
“`方法三:使用LAMP/WAMP/XAMPP等集成环境
1. LAMP:Linux + Apache + MySQL + PHP。可以通过以下命令来安装LAMP环境。
“`
sudo apt install apache2 mysql-server php libapache2-mod-php php-mysql
“`2. WAMP:Windows + Apache + MySQL + PHP。可以从WampServer官网(https://www.wampserver.com/)下载并安装WampServer。
3. XAMPP:跨平台的Apache + MySQL + PHP + Perl环境。可以从XAMPP官网(https://www.apachefriends.org/index.html)下载并安装XAMPP。
安装完成后,可以通过访问服务器的IP地址或本地主机来测试PHP环境。
总结:
以上就是在服务器上安装PHP环境的几种常见方法。选择合适的方法根据你的操作系统和需求,然后根据具体的安装步骤进行操作。无论你选择哪种方法,都需要确保在安装前备份重要数据,并且仔细阅读相关文档和说明。
2年前